Burning Man attendees head home as rain dries
Tens of thousands of Burning Man attendees have finally left the Nevada desert where the festival takes place as the muddy conditions that left many stranded over the weekend improved.
The annual burning of a massive wooden man that marks the close of the festival took place Monday night, after several postponements.

US Senate back from recess as gvt shutdown looms
Lawmakers returning to the US Senate following the summer recess are heading straight into negotiations in the face of an impending government shutdown.
With just weeks spare, a bipartisan group of Senators in Congress's Democratic-controlled upper chamber are trying to pass a months-long funding measure to keep federal offices running while legislators iron out a budget, as Benji Hyer reports.

Row in India over use of word "Bharat" as name of country
A row has been triggered in India as dinner invitations have been sent out to dignitaries attending the G20 summit this week from the "president of Bharat" rather than the usual description, the president of India.
"Bharat" is a Hindi word for India.

Japan boosts aid to seafood sector as Fukushima fishers consider legal action
Japan’s government is boosting financial support for the fishing sector after China placed a blanket ban on the country's seafood.
The ban is in protest to Tokyo’s decision to begin discharging treated water, used to cool the wrecked Fukushima Nuclear Power Plant, into the ocean last month.

NK leader set to meet Putin in Russia
The North Korean leader Kim Jong Un is set to make a rare trip out of his country to Russia - to discuss supplying weapons for use against Ukraine with President Vladmir Putin, according to the New York Times.
On Wednesday the White House warned it had intelligence to show that military cooperation between the two countries was "actively advancing".
